Output 23659d345fa77537df224ecc55398c975ff0475fff2150cb1d5a4914f5c1cb1a:1

value
33301180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bcf84fb85e041a5c7e609b423efb6cd0a4665014 OP_EQUALVERIFY OP_CHECKSIG
address
1JEBW3W8BkZvcUodMQ6wajK2dFi5BVafcp
transaction
23659d345fa77537df224ecc55398c975ff0475fff2150cb1d5a4914f5c1cb1a
confirmations
454368
spent
true